In Slater's 1960 standard work on confluent hypergeometric functions, also called Kummer functions, a number of asymptotic expansions of these functions can be found. We summarize expansions derived from a differential equation for large values of the a-parameter. We show how similar expansions can be derived by using integral representations, and we observe discrepancies with Slater's expansions.
